Royal Enfield Bear 650: Top 5 things to keep in mind

The Bear is the tallest and the lightest 650 cc motorcycle in the Royal Enfield portfolio.

Royal Enfield Bear 650
Image: Royal Enfield

Royal Enfield has paid tribute to Eddie Mulder, the youngest-ever winner of the Big Bear Run desert race in California in 1960. The brand has further strengthened its presence in the 650cc segment by unveiling the Bear 650 at EICMA 2024, marking the launch of its first Scrambler in this category. The Bear 650 joins Royal Enfield’s growing 650cc lineup, which now includes six models, with the highly anticipated Classic 650 set to launch soon in the Indian market.

Here are five things one should keep in mind about the new Bear 650.

Royal Enfield Bear 650: Powertrain Specs

The brand-new Bear 650 is powered by the 650-cc parallel-twin air-cooled engine with an output of 47 bhp at 7,250 rpm like the other bikes in the Royal Enfield portfolio, but the Scrambler 56.5 Nm at 5,160 rpm, which has additional torque of 4.3 Nm. The Bear 650 doesn’t get the typical twin exhausts like its siblings rather it has a two-in-one single exhaust. This setup has also allowed the Bear 650 to be around 2 kg lighter than the Interceptor 650. It is mated to a 6-speed gearbox with slip-assist clutch. 

Royal Enfield Bear 650: Chassis and Hardware

The Bear 650 is based on a steel tubular double cradle frame like the other 650 cc motorcycles. It sports dual-purpose tyres with 19-inch in front and 17 at the rear. The new motorcycle borrows the suspension set up from the Shotgun 650. It is equipped with Showa upside-down 43 mm front forks with a wheel travel of 130 mm while getting twin shocks with a wheel travel of 115 mm. The motorcycle is equipped with a 320mm front disc and 270mm rear disc with dual channel ABS with switchable off at the rear.

Royal Enfield Bear 650: Dimensions

The Bear 650’s wheelbase is 1460 mm and has a ground clearance of 184 mm. Being a Scrambler, it has a taller stance, hence, the seat height is 830 mm and a kerb weight of 216 kg. The Bear 650’s fuel tank capacity is 13.7 litres. 

Royal Enfield Bear 650 Specs
Wheelbase1460 mm
Ground Clearance184 mm
Length2180 mm
Width855 mm
Height1160 mm
Seat Height830 mm

Royal Enfield Bear 650: Features

The Bear 650 sports all LED lights including the headlamp and taillights. Like the Himalayan 450, the Scrambler gets a 4-inch TFT display with inbuilt Google Maps, remote live location tracking, real-time last parked location, vehicle alerts, vehicle dashboard, trip reports etc. It also has a USB Type-C charger.

Royal Enfield Bear 650: Prices

Royal Enfield launched the Bear 650 starting from Rs 3.39 lakh, ex-showroom. It is available in five colours — Broadwalk White, Petrol Green, Wild Honey, Golden Shadow and Two Four Nine. 

Royal Enfield Bear 650 prices, ex-showroom Chennai
Broadwalk WhiteRs 3.39 lakh
Petrol GreenRs 3.44 lakh
Wild HoneyRs 3.44 lakh
Golden ShadowRs 3.51 lakh
Two Four NineRs 3.59 lakh
